An exceptional and highly sought-after collector’s piece from John Galliano’s legendary era at Dior. This Fall 2000 dress is executed in the same iconic silhouette as the famous newspaper print dress worn by Carrie Bradshaw in Sex and the City — here reimagined in a sensual leopard execution with sheer golden lace appliqué.
The dress features a fluid, body-skimming cut in a heavy stretch viscose knit, designed to contour and flatter the figure. A softly draped cowl neckline, delicate straps adorned with gold-tone “CD” hardware, and an asymmetrical hemline create effortless movement and unmistakable early-2000s Galliano sensuality. Transparent golden lace patches are appliquéd throughout, adding texture, dimension, and a subtle play on transparency.
This exact style appeared on the Fall 2000 runway and was later seen on supermodels Bella Hadid and Anok Yai, reaffirming its status as one of the most collectible Dior slip silhouettes.
